What it is

Acrylate/C10-30 Alkyl Acrylate Crosspolymer is a synthetic crosslinked acrylic polymer used to thicken aqueous formulations, stabilize emulsions, and suspend particles, producing smooth gel-cream textures. It is a formulation base ingredient rather than a therapeutic active.

Side effects reported in research

Reported effectHow oftenNotes
Skin irritationRareGenerally considered low-irritation; mild transient irritation possible, often linked to other formula components or neutralizing agents.
Allergic contact dermatitisVery rareSensitization to the polymer itself is uncommonly reported in the literature.
Eye irritationUncommonCan cause mild stinging if formulations contact the eyes.

Frequencies reflect typical cosmetic use reported in the literature, not a guarantee for your skin.
